CAMPUS STORES CONFERENCE 2025
NEW DATES February 10-13, 2025!
We heard from many of you that the 2025 conference was going to conflict with a number of other community commitments, so we changed the dates of next year’s conference. We’ll be returning to Le Centre Sheraton in Montreal, Quebec for another Campus Stores Conference from February 10-13, 2025! NACS TEXTBOOK AFFORDABILITY CONFERENCE
Supporting Student Success
What can you do to collaborate on campus about course materials and affordability?
How can you learn from colleagues across the higher education community and come away
with an action plan for your campus?
In a two-day working conference, you will interact with a diverse mix of campus professionals; explore textbook affordability strategies; exchange ideas with colleagues; and energize your leadership and confidence. Collectively, through the sharing of success stories, effective practices, and solutions, you and your team can create affordability strategies to implement on your campus.
The Westin O’Hare | Chicago, IL
November 7-8, 2024
